close

Self Generating Photovoltaic System (Net Metering) in a juice industry of 20 kW Power

Self Generating Photovoltaic System (Net Metering) in a juice industry of  20 kW Power

Self Generating Photovoltaic System (Net Metering) in a juice industry of 20 kW Power